How Easy is it to Make Money Playing Online Poker?

There is a massive earning potential playing online poker but it's by no means easy money. There are easier ways to make money than playing online poker - but that doesn't mean it isn't for you. Much like any other pastime, it takes time to learn how to become proficient and this takes patience and dedication. One of the questions we get asked most by players starting out is how much they could make. Unfortunately, this isn't an easy question to answer. Every player is different and the amount any one player wins or loses will come down to how good they are. Sadly, not everyone will have the ability to turn a profit - it's a good idea not to risk too much until you know that you have what it takes.

 

It might come as a surprise that there are considerably more losers to the game who fail to post a profit playing poker online. It's estimated that as many as 70% of all internet players fail to make a profit in the long run. This goes a long way to answering the question on how easy it is to make money playing internet poker.

Earn Rates - Cash Games Vs Tournaments

It is important to remember that the amounts you can earn vary quite a bit depending on whether you chose to play tournaments or ring games. Cash game players are more prone to making more regular profits but they do miss out on the larger scores enjoyed by a deep run in an MTT. Since 2013, the number of game formats has exploded and there are now more and more formats that have helped drive up the hands played per hour and overall win rates.

 

In cash games online, a solid player might expect to earn between 3-5 BB every 50 hands played. This would double in live cash games as the games online are considered tougher. Whilst many think a win rate above 0 is good, they fail to take onto account the rake paid. A positive win rate is a profit once you have taken into account the level of rake that you have contributed.

 

In tournaments, good players generally cash ITM around 15% of the time. Of course on it's own, this doesn't mean much. After all, if a player was to min cash in 15% of the tournaments they played in, the might not even break even - especially as a min cash is not a huge amount over the initial buy in. It's crucial that you know how to play for the final table and ultimately the win.

Improving Your Win Rate / Earning Potential

Good players are always looking for ways to improve their earning potential. They explore new techniques and methods to reduce their risk and maximise their profits. Do do this, you need to understand what you do well and more importantly where your leaks are. We shouldn't discount either of these. We might do something well but there are always adjustments that we can make to extract more from our opponents. Similarly, when we put our game under the spotlight, we will be able to see where we are not doing so well. For example, you might find that you are constantly losing the biggest amounts of money in particular situations. It might be that you are playing too many hands, which we know is a not a profitable play. Making reasonable adjustments in these spots can kill these leaks and lead to higher earnings.

 

As the game is constantly evolving, we need to evolve with the game too. What worked yesterday won't necessarily work tomorrow. You can keep up with changes on the felt by reading up on developments and trends in how people are playing. There is a ton of information on poker forums, strategy sites and the many videos that are available online. You can also pick up good techniques watching the top players play online. The biggest names in the game are in action most nights and you can learn a lot watching them play.

 

Another area we can improve is on the mental side of the game. Learning when we play our best and when we don't will help increase earnings. Also understanding our optimum set up to ensure we induce our best game. Reviewing our game needs to take into account any factor that could contribute to either our state of mind or our ability to play our A-game.

Tracking Your Online Poker Results

It's important to track your online results. If you are playing in cash games, keep a track of how much you take to the tables and how much you cash out. If you're a tournament player, keep a track of all your buy ins and cashes. It's crucial to know whether you are posting a profit or are operating in the red. The way you will be able to tell that you are getting better in the long run is by tracking these results to see how much you are making. You also want to be in the know if you are losing money. By making changes to your game, you can see first hand whether the changes are having a positive or negative effect by how much money you are making or losing at the felt.
